Basseterre, Saint Kitts and Nevis, January 31, 2023 [Press Secretary’s Office]: Her Excellency Ms. Marcella Liburd JP will be sworn in live tonight [Tuesday 31st January 2023] at 11:50pm at Government House, Springfield, Basseterre, St. Kitts as the Governor-General of Saint Kitts, and Nevis. This is a historic moment for our Federation as she will be the first female Governor-General.Ms. Liburd will succeed His Excellency Sir S.W. Tapley Seaton GCMG, CVO, KC, JP, LL.D.Her Excellency Marcella Liburd has served St. Kitts and Nevis in various capacities, as a teacher, lawyer, Senator, Deputy Speaker, Speaker of the National Assembly, and Cabinet Minister of…

27 January 2023, Basseterre, Saint Christopher (St Kitts) and Nevis – The Eastern Caribbean Central Bank (ECCB) has announced the winners of its stamp competition which was held as part of the activities to mark the Bank’s 40th anniversary. Vedant Shetty of Saint Vincent and the Grenadines is the winner in the 5-11 category, Mea Emmanuel of Saint Lucia is the winner in the 12-17 category and Maxanne Rocke of Saint Vincent and the Grenadines is the winner in the 18 and over category. The winners were recognised and awarded during the official launch of the Bank’s 40th Anniversary celebrations…

Basseterre, St. Kitts (30 January 2023) – Today, P&O cruise vessel “Arvia” made its inaugural cruise call to St. Kitts. The Authority continues to honor inaugural cruise calls, representing the consistent growth of the destination’s cruise sector. Arvia boasts of its excel class ship title operating with a capacity of 5,200 guests and 1,800 crew members. The cruise vessel measures 345m, 184,700 tons, and has 15 guest decks while offering a swim-up bar, fine-dining restaurants, multiple aqua-zones, and even an onboard blending rum class.“I am pleased to welcome Arvia to St. Kitts on its maiden cruise call,” shared Honourable Marsha T.
